起步软件技术论坛
搜索
 找回密码
 注册

QQ登录

只需一步,快速开始

查看: 4298|回复: 18

[处理中3] 单点模拟登录调用方法 执行慢

[复制链接]

66

主题

284

帖子

3205

积分

论坛元老

Rank: 8Rank: 8

积分
3205
QQ
发表于 2023-1-19 08:35:32 | 显示全部楼层 |阅读模式
版本: X5.2.7 小版本号:
数据库: Oracle 服务器操作系统: Windows 应用服务器: Tomcat
客户端操作系统: Windows 其它 浏览器: Chrome
我们系统单点登录 模拟登录调用的以下图片的访问,要3分左右,才能登录成功。直接通过login.w登录,速度很快。帮分析下这是什么原因。   $.jpolite.Data.system.User.login(username,password, language, {},function(data){                                        if(data && data.status){
                                        alert(data.status);
                                                window.location.href = window.location.href.replace(/mgrLogin.*\.w.*/,page);
                                        }else{
                                                window.location.href = window.location.href.replace(/mgrLogin.*\.w.*/,'login.w');
                                        }

1111.png

91

主题

13万

帖子

3万

积分

管理员

Rank: 9Rank: 9Rank: 9

积分
36067
发表于 2023-1-19 09:14:23 | 显示全部楼层
网络请求监控看具体什么地方慢

model\UI\portal下提供的有html文件给的有集成的案例
而且提供的有portal用的login.j登录的/UI/demo/actions/process/integration下都有案例
远程的联系方法QQ1392416607,添加好友时,需在备注里注明其论坛名字及ID,公司等信息
发远程时同时也发一下帖子地址,方便了解要解决的问题  WeX5教程  WeX5下载



如按照该方法解决,请及时跟帖,便于版主结贴
回复 支持 反对

使用道具 举报

66

主题

284

帖子

3205

积分

论坛元老

Rank: 8Rank: 8

积分
3205
QQ
 楼主| 发表于 2023-1-19 10:19:30 | 显示全部楼层
jishuang 发表于 2023-1-19 09:14
网络请求监控看具体什么地方慢

model%uI\portal下提供的有html文件给的有集成的案例

http://192.168.99.63:8080/x5/portal/controller/system/User/login          调这个方法时  慢了。
回复 支持 反对

使用道具 举报

66

主题

284

帖子

3205

积分

论坛元老

Rank: 8Rank: 8

积分
3205
QQ
 楼主| 发表于 2023-1-19 10:23:32 | 显示全部楼层
这个登录方法 应该是 login.w中的登录是调用的相同方法吧。为什么login.w中登录不慢。调用这个就慢了
回复 支持 反对

使用道具 举报

91

主题

13万

帖子

3万

积分

管理员

Rank: 9Rank: 9Rank: 9

积分
36067
发表于 2023-1-19 13:57:54 | 显示全部楼层
1.安装监控工具,监控具体慢的请求,这个只是前端的调用方法
2.sql执行时间打印出来看看是不是sql执行慢
http://bbs.wex5.com/forum.php?mo ... 4&pid=165004035
远程的联系方法QQ1392416607,添加好友时,需在备注里注明其论坛名字及ID,公司等信息
发远程时同时也发一下帖子地址,方便了解要解决的问题  WeX5教程  WeX5下载



如按照该方法解决,请及时跟帖,便于版主结贴
回复 支持 反对

使用道具 举报

66

主题

284

帖子

3205

积分

论坛元老

Rank: 8Rank: 8

积分
3205
QQ
 楼主| 发表于 2023-1-29 08:37:00 | 显示全部楼层
附件中是  打印的sql,帮分析下。

justep.biz.zip

82.51 KB, 下载次数: 68

回复 支持 反对

使用道具 举报

66

主题

284

帖子

3205

积分

论坛元老

Rank: 8Rank: 8

积分
3205
QQ
 楼主| 发表于 2023-1-29 11:40:01 | 显示全部楼层
这个中间做了什么操作。用了2分钟。
QQ图片20230129113934.png
回复 支持 反对

使用道具 举报

91

主题

13万

帖子

3万

积分

管理员

Rank: 9Rank: 9Rank: 9

积分
36067
发表于 2023-1-30 09:30:10 | 显示全部楼层
jdk的jstack命令可以看堆栈信息 https://www.jianshu.com/p/8d5782bc596e

开启平台的JVM跟踪日志还可以同start和end的标志看action具体的执行时间
       修改%JUSTEP_HOME%/runtime/BusinessServer/WEB-INF/justep.log.properties文件,在最后添加以下代码:
log4j.logger.com.justep.log.jvm=DEBUG,CONSOLE
log4j.additivity.com.justep.log.jvm=false
        修改完后, 重启服务器,执行任何action时, 服务器控制台应该可以看到类似以下的日志:
2018-12-12 18:15:45 [JVM]start...DC9DC824E8084AD1BBF965E83D927896, process: /demo/process/process/and/andProcess, activity: bizActivity1, action: queryOrderAction
2018-12-12 18:15:45 [JVM]end.....DC9DC824E8084AD1BBF965E83D927896, process: /demo/process/process/and/andProcess, activity: bizActivity1, action: queryOrderAction, operator: PSN01, system, total: 4095MB, free: 1172MB, use: 2922MB, leak free: 1MB, leak use: 0
远程的联系方法QQ1392416607,添加好友时,需在备注里注明其论坛名字及ID,公司等信息
发远程时同时也发一下帖子地址,方便了解要解决的问题  WeX5教程  WeX5下载



如按照该方法解决,请及时跟帖,便于版主结贴
回复 支持 反对

使用道具 举报

66

主题

284

帖子

3205

积分

论坛元老

Rank: 8Rank: 8

积分
3205
QQ
 楼主| 发表于 2023-1-31 15:59:45 | 显示全部楼层
jishuang 发表于 2023-1-30 09:30
jdk的jstack命令可以看堆栈信息 https://www.jianshu.com/p/8d5782bc596e

开启平台的JVM跟踪日志还可以同s ...

看附件图片,loginAction   要执行   action执行时间:9995ms
QQ截图20230131155833.png
回复 支持 反对

使用道具 举报

91

主题

13万

帖子

3万

积分

管理员

Rank: 9Rank: 9Rank: 9

积分
36067
发表于 2023-2-1 14:35:01 | 显示全部楼层
如果是loginAction慢,那应该是都慢,模拟登录和门户登录用同一个帐号测试
远程的联系方法QQ1392416607,添加好友时,需在备注里注明其论坛名字及ID,公司等信息
发远程时同时也发一下帖子地址,方便了解要解决的问题  WeX5教程  WeX5下载



如按照该方法解决,请及时跟帖,便于版主结贴
回复 支持 反对

使用道具 举报

您需要登录后才可以回帖 登录 | 注册

本版积分规则

小黑屋|手机版|X3技术论坛|Justep Inc.    

GMT+8, 2024-11-24 09:22 , Processed in 0.089104 second(s), 28 queries .

Powered by Discuz! X3.4

© 2001-2013 Comsenz Inc.

快速回复 返回顶部 返回列表